The following are the duties of this position at the full working level. If this vacancy includes more than one grade and you are selected at a lower grade level, you will have the opportunity to learn to perform these duties and receive training to help you grow in this position. Independently or as a Team Leader, serves as a technical expert for Compliance Domain systems development and undertakes technically complex projects/studies requiring coordination across functional lines service-wide. Develops or assists other developers with software applications for the PC/Server/Web portal environment, using languages and technologies such as Java, J2EE, XML, HTML, SOAP, SQL, DB2, Oracle, other object oriented language and/or other Web technologies. This includes understanding syntax, creating, compiling, executing, testing, and debugging programs, functions, and objects. Is an expert senior technical advisor and Team Leader providing the full range of analytical and advisory support services, including the recommendation of programs and policies. Provides guidance and assistance on the entire range of technical issues, especially in development program areas. Evaluates and interprets comprehensive systemic change requests and makes recommendations to management. Plans, organizes, and/or leads corporate or large-scale studies, projects, or team efforts which include other subject matter specialists, and involves highly technical computer issues.
